## Releases

ShelfStream publishes catalogue-import builds monthly. Plugin authors must target the import schema pinned in each release tag; MARC-variant mappings change between minors, so re-run the Stackwise conformance suite before publishing. Unsigned plugin bundles are rejected by the registry. All official ShelfStream artifacts are signed; verify downloads before building against them using the key below.

release key, yafof-kadup: bky4_soBk

Subject: Bulk edits shipping to Ledgerpane admin. Team — tonight's release enables multi-row bulk edits in the admin table. Support should know: edits apply atomically, and a failed row rolls back the whole batch with a banner explaining why. Undo is available for ten minutes after commit. If a customer reports a stuck batch, gather the batch summary and quote the release token below when escalating.

session token of bawep-yadup = htk21_528abd376e3c5a4ec24a1

Subject: Scanner integration live in staging

Team — the Brindlemark barcode scanner integration is deployed to staging. New folks: scan tests go through the Packhouse simulator, not real hardware. Known gap: GS1 composite codes aren't parsed yet; file anything else you find. Full rollout decision Friday. The staging deploy carries the build token listed just below this message.

pipeline stamp: htk9_ce63042d9

## Report Export Timezone Recovery — Quartzline

If exports show shifted timestamps, the scheduler lost its zone offset after an account reset. Re-link the export account in Quartzline admin, set zone to the tenant default, and re-run the last three jobs. Do not backfill manually; the dedupe pass handles overlaps. If the export service account itself is locked, trigger recovery from the Helm console. Recovery requires the stored passphrase, which follows:

vault phrase of hahop-badug = novvan-ulaion-zorius-noviel-gorwyn-casix-tamys